5 Things You Need to Know About Cleveland Heights This Week
City Council and School Board meetings, 9/11 memorial concert in Public Square and more
1. Cleveland Heights City Hall, the Community Center and Cleveland Heights-University Heights Schools are closed for Labor Day.
2. The Cleveland Heights-University Heights School Board is meeting at 7 p.m. Tuesday at the Board of Education building for its first regular meeting of the 2011-2012 school year.
3. The Cleveland Heights City Council Meeting is at 7:30 p.m. Tuesday in City Hall.
4. Cleveland Heights-University Heights students who are a part of the youth chorus are performing with the Cleveland Orchestra at 5 p.m. Sunday in a free 9/11 memorial concert in Public Square.
5. The North Union Farmers Market is hosting the second Cleveland Garlic Festival from 1 p.m. to 9 p.m. Sept. 10 and noon to 6 p.m. Sept. 11 at Shaker Square. Local chefs will prepare garlic-themed foods, and the event will also include live music, a celebrity chef grill-off and other activities. For more information, visit www.clevelandgarlicfestival.org.
